Gluten Free Nut andamp; Seed Energy Cookies

Description

These Gluten Free Nut and Seed Energy Cookies are the ultimate healthy snack. Packed with oats, chia, flax, and dried fruit, they are chewy, satisfying, and perfect for on-the-go fuel.


Ingredients

Scale

1 cup rolled oats (Must be ‘Certified Gluten-Free’)

½ cup mixed nuts (cashews, almonds, walnuts), roughly chopped

¼ cup pumpkin seeds

2 tbsp chia seeds

2 tbsp flaxseeds

½ cup dried cranberries (or raisins)

¼ cup natural peanut butter or almond butter

¼ cup honey or maple syrup

1 tsp vanilla extract

½ tsp cinnamon

Pinch of salt


Instructions

1. Preheat oven to 325°F (160°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.

2. In a large mixing bowl, combine the certified gluten-free oats, chopped nuts, pumpkin seeds, chia seeds, flaxseeds, dried cranberries, cinnamon, and salt. Stir to distribute spices evenly.

3. In a small saucepan over low heat (or in the microwave), melt the peanut butter and honey together until smooth. Stir in the vanilla extract.

4. Pour the warm wet mixture over the dry ingredients. Stir immediately until every oat and seed is fully coated and sticky.

5. Using a cookie scoop, place mounds of dough onto the prepared baking sheet.

6. Flatten each mound into a round cookie shape using the back of a spoon or your hand (these cookies do not spread while baking).

7. Bake for 12–15 minutes until the edges are golden and the cookies feel firm.

8. Allow to cool completely on a wire rack to set before eating.

Notes

**Oats Warning:** You must use oats labeled ‘Certified Gluten-Free’ to ensure this recipe is safe for Celiac diets.

**Vegan Option:** Use maple syrup instead of honey.

**Nut-Free Option:** Substitute mixed nuts for sunflower seeds or gluten-free crispy rice cereal, and use sunflower seed butter instead of peanut butter.

**Storage:** Store in an airtight container for 1 week at room temperature.
